Lake Superior College is a 2-4 years, public school located in Duluth, Minnesota. The school offers undergraduate degree programs only. For the academic year 2023-2024, the tuition & fees are $6,404 for Minnesota residents and $5,786 for other students on average.

It offers 106 degree programs. Of that, the distance learning opportunity is given to 16 programs - 9 Certificate, 7 Associates.

Distance Learning Program Student Population

At Lake Superior College, there are 3,849 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 1,870 students were attending classes through distance learning (899 students are enrolled exclusively and 971 are enrolled in some online courses).

By student location, out of a total of 899 enrolled exclusively in online courses, 762 Minnesota Residents were enrolled in online classes exclusively, 130 students living in the U.S. States other than Minnesota, and 0 non-U.S. students enrolled in online courses.
